Featured dishes

View full menu
Fried Chicken
Tender chunks of fried chicken, black olives, egg slices and topped with cheddar cheese.
Chef Salad
Tasty turkey, ham, black olives, tomato, egg slices topped cheddar cheese and mozzarella.
Grilled Chicken
Grilled chicken, tomato black olives and egg slices topped with cheddar cheese.
Lyndlee's Favorite
Marinated boneless skinless chicken served on a bed of mixed greens topped with eggs, strawberries, tomato, pecans and cheddar cheese.

Susan KuzmicSusan Kuzmic
The food is bland at best, not at all tasty. They were out of blue cheese dressing. My vegetarian skillet was served WITHOUT SALSA ON THE SIDE as the menu indicates. I have uploaded a photo of the leftover I brought home. You can see that there are big chunks of potato and microbites of onion, tomato, green pepper and brocolli. I didn't order a plate of potatoes with microbites of veggies. I ordered the vegetarian skillet with salsa on the side. The menu says you get a side of salsa--which wasn't served to me. The eggs were tasteless also. The sourdough toast was really sourdough bread with a bite of butter in the middle. It was not toasted at all. The flavors were ho hum. No spice of life here. Blandest food I have had at a restaurant in years. Totally disappointed!

Matthew NicholsMatthew Nichols
First time trying this restaurant. We walked in about 9:45am and not too many people. Which was great for us because our food came out fast. Wife had some eggs and hasbrown which she said was so good. I tried their Greek skillet. It was so much food. I could not even eat half of what was given me. The prices are very affordable. I paid $12 for my breakfast and I had more than enough to take home for lunch. Please come and check this place out. The brunch rush came in at 10 and not an open seat so come early.
